How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Port Orchard?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heap Port Orchard Studio Apartments | $1,686 | $1,000 | $2,019 |
| Cheap Port Orchard 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,748 | $1,194 | $2,400 |
| Cheap Port Orchard 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,094 | $1,192 | $2,540 |
| Cheap Port Orchard 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,221 | $1,204 | $3,399 |
| Cheap Port Orchard 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,073 | $2,073 | $2,073 |

Cheapest Available Port Orchard Apartments for Rent
 The cheapest available apartment rental in Port Orchard, WA is a Studio unit found at 4th Street Apartments in the West Bremerton neighborhood priced from $1,000. Conifer Woods Apartments has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 2 Beds apartment currently listed from $1,192.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Port Orchard apartments for rent: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| 4th Street Apartments | Studio | Studio,1BA | $1,000 |
| Conifer Woods Apartments | 2-Bedroom Tax Credit | 2BR,1BA | $1,192 |
| Broadway Manor Apartments | unit A | 1BR,1BA | $1,195 |
| Milano Apartments | 0BR/1.0BA | Studio,1BA | $1,250 |
| 952 Highland Ave | One Bed One Bath | 1BR,1BA | $1,290 |
| Azure Apartments | 1x1 1 | 1BR,1BA | $1,400 |
| Quincy Square Apartments | 1 BR /1 BA | 1BR,1BA | $1,400 |
| Pottery Creek Apartments | Studio | Studio,1BA | $1,495 |
| Park Ridge Apartments | 2x1 - Renovated | 2BR,1BA | $1,499 |
